Are Sweet Plantains Healthy?

Cooked plantains are very similar to potatoes nutritionally, calorically, but contain more of certain vitamins and minerals.they are a rich source of fiber, vitamins A, C and B-6, and the minerals magnesium and potassium. This hidden superfood is worth a trip to your local grocery store.

Do plantains make you fat?

plantain is a low fat source Starchy carbohydrates and fiber. They also contain high amounts of vitamins and minerals, including vitamin C and potassium. According to the USDA, 1 cup of roasted yellow plantains contains: 239 calories.

Are plantains high in sugar?

Plantains are high in starch – they are not as sweet as bananas.when they are mature more sugar may be formedso their meat becomes sweeter.

Is plantain healthier than rice?

Although the numbers are very close, plantains have some Advantages over white rice« They have more vitamins and minerals, and more fiber, » says Isabella Ferrari, MCN, RD, LD, clinical dietitian, Parkland Memorial Hospital, Dallas.

How fat are fried plantains?

Frying plantain will add some fat. Making them at home can help you control the amount of fat you want to use.These fried sweet plantains have 196 calories32 grams of carbohydrate, 9 grams of fat, and 1 gram of protein per serving (when you divide into 3 servings).

When should plantains be eaten?

Mature plantains are the best when it’s mostly black and a little yellow, and still a little firm to the touch, like when you squeeze peaches. While all-black plantains are still delicious, they’re a little too soft to prepare. But they are still delicious.
